  • - The Knights of Labor in Ontario, 1880-1900
    av Bryan D. Palmer & Gregory S. Kealey
    690,-

    This book examines the rise and fall of the Noble and Holy Order of the Knights of Labor, an organisation which embodied a late nineteenth-century working-class vision of an alternative to the developing industrial-capitalist society. Case studies of Toronto and Hamilton chronicle the movement's impact across Ontario.
